Roof Flashing Installation in Voorhees, NJ
Roof flashing installation involves adding protective metal strips around key areas of a roof, such as chimneys, vents, skylights, and roof joints, to prevent water from seeping into the structure. This service is essential for both new construction projects and repairs, helping to ensure that the roof remains watertight and durable over time. Homeowners typically request roof flashing installation when constructing a new roof, upgrading existing flashing, or addressing leaks and water intrusion issues around roof penetrations and edges.
Before requesting roof flashing installation, property owners often want to understand the types of flashing materials available, such as aluminum, copper, or galvanized steel, and how they suit different roofing materials and climates. It's also common to inquire about the scope of work, including whether existing flashing needs removal or repair, and how the installation process might impact the roof’s warranty or longevity. Having clear information about these aspects can help homeowners make informed decisions to protect their property from water damage.

Common Roof Flashing Installation Jobs
Roof flashing installation involves sealing roof joints to prevent water intrusion.
Valley flashing directs runoff away from roof intersections and prevents leaks.
Chimney flashing creates a watertight seal around chimney bases to protect the structure.
Vent pipe flashing ensures proper sealing around roof penetrations for ventilation systems.
Skylight flashing provides a weatherproof seal around skylights to prevent leaks.
Step flashing is used along roof edges to direct water away from walls and prevent damage.
Roof Flashing Installation Questions
What is roof flashing installation? It involves adding metal strips around roof features to prevent water leaks and protect the structure.
When is roof flashing replacement needed? Replacement is recommended if existing flashing is damaged, rusted, or has become loose over time.
What types of roof features require flashing? Flashing is typically installed around chimneys, vents, skylights, and roof valleys for proper water diversion.
Why is proper flashing installation important? Correct installation helps prevent water intrusion, reduces the risk of leaks, and extends the roof’s lifespan.
